CVE-2026-62795: Windows LDAP - Lightweight Directory Access Protocol Remote Code Execution Vulnerability
Use after free in Windows LDAP - Lightweight Directory Access Protocol allows an unauthorized attacker to execute code over a network.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is the severity of CVE-2026-62795?
CVE-2026-62795 has a severity rating of 8.8, indicating a high level of risk.
How do I fix CVE-2026-62795?
To address CVE-2026-62795, users should apply the latest security patches provided by Microsoft for affected Windows versions.
What are the affected software versions for CVE-2026-62795?
CVE-2026-62795 affects Microsoft Windows 10, Windows 11, Windows Server 2012 R2, Windows Server 2019, Windows Server 2012, Windows Server 2016, Windows Server 2025, and Windows Server 2022.
What type of vulnerability is CVE-2026-62795?
CVE-2026-62795 is classified as a Use After Free vulnerability in the Windows LDAP protocol.
What is the potential impact of exploiting CVE-2026-62795?
An unauthorized attacker exploiting CVE-2026-62795 could execute arbitrary code on affected systems, leading to significant security risks.
